How are Service protection API limits enforced?

Service protection API limits are enforced based on three facets: The number of requests sent by a user. The combined execution time required to process requests sent by a user. The number of concurrent requests sent by a user. If the only limit was on the number of requests sent by a user, it would be possible to bypass it.

What are the API quota limits?

General quota limits. The following quotas apply to Management API, Core Reporting API v3, MCF Reporting API, Metadata API, User Deletion API, and Real Time Reporting API: 50,000 requests per project per day, which can be increased. 10 queries per second (QPS) per IP address.

What is API rate limiting?

To prevent an API from being overwhelmed, API owners often enforce a limit on the number of requests, or the quantity of data clients can consume. This is called Application Rate Limiting. If a user sends too many requests, API rate limiting can throttle client connections instead of disconnecting them immediately.
